Schießstand Werlte is a shooting range for clay target shooting and hunting firearms sports, located in the city of Werlte (Lower Saxony, Germany). The facility caters to both beginners and experienced shooters and is one of the largest ranges of its kind in the region.
Clay target shooting is the main focus of the range. The trap area features an "Olympic level" layout with 15 machines, supporting both sporting and hunting disciplines of trap shooting. A combined trap/skeet layout operates separately. For sporting and compact sporting, there are four dedicated layouts with over 100 automatic machines — one of the largest hunting park-sportings in Germany. The "rollhase" discipline is also available. Own cartridges are permitted; cartridges and clays can be purchased on-site.
In addition to clay target disciplines, the range offers a rifle range with several lanes at 100 m and a running boar lane (50 m), as well as a pistol range with six lanes at 25 m. Shotgun rentals are available for guests without their own firearms; hearing protection is included in the basic package for beginners. A shooting school operates with courses for beginners and preparation for hunting exams, as well as training in various disciplines upon request. The range features a pro shop for hunting firearms and equipment, a club room with hot and cold kitchen facilities, and a barbecue area. Regular competitions and corporate events are held.
